Frequently asked questions about Sherman El
How many students attend Sherman El?
Sherman El has 453 students enrolled. It is a public school in Houston, TX. CCD year-over-year: 528 (2022-23) → 478 (2023-24), down 50.
What is the student-teacher ratio at Sherman El?
The student-teacher ratio at Sherman El is 17.4:1, which is 18% higher than the Texas average of 14.7:1 and 11% higher than the national average of 15.7:1.
What percentage of students receive free lunch at Sherman El?
97.0% of students at Sherman El are eligible for free lunch, compared to the Texas average of 61.9%.
What is the racial and ethnic makeup of Sherman El?
The largest demographic group at Sherman El is Hispanic or Latino at 90.7% of enrollment, in Houston, TX.
What is the Resource Investment Index for Sherman El?
Sherman El has a Resource Investment Index of 43/100 (typical reported resources relative to schools nationally) based on 3 factors: student-teacher ratio, gifted-program reporting, chronic absenteeism. Not a test-score or academic measure (national median ~41/100, see methodology).
